I have been exploring UI/UX design courses recently, and one thing I realized is that choosing the right course is not as simple as it looks. There are many options available, especially in a city like Pune, so it is important to understand what actually matters before enrolling.

One of the first things to check is the course structure. A good UI/UX course should not focus only on tools. It should start with design basics like color theory, typography, layout, and visual hierarchy. These fundamentals help in building a strong base. Without them, learning tools alone will not be very useful in the long run.

Another important factor is how much practical learning is included.UI/UX Design Course in Pune is a skill that improves with practice. Courses that include assignments, real-world projects, and case studies are usually more helpful. Working on projects gives a better understanding of how the design process actually works.

User research is also something that should not be ignored. Many beginners think UI/UX is only about making designs look good, but it is more about solving user problems. A good course should teach how to understand user behavior, create personas, and improve the overall user experience.

Portfolio building is another key point to consider. From what I have seen, companies pay more attention to portfolios than certificates. So it is important to choose a course that helps in creating proper case studies and guides you on how to present your work.

It is also helpful if the course includes some level of career guidance. Things like resume building, interview preparation, and feedback on portfolio can make a big difference, especially for beginners.

Batch timing and flexibility are also worth checking, especially if someone is working or studying. Many courses offer weekend or flexible options, which can make learning more manageable.

Overall, I feel the best approach is to compare a few options, check their syllabus, and maybe attend a demo session before deciding. UI/UX is definitely a good career option, but choosing the right course can make the learning journey much smoother and more effective.
